SL90
Manufacturer Honda
Also called Motosport 90
Production 1969
Class Dual-sport
Engine 89cc OHC single-cylinder four-stroke
Transmission 4-speed manual
Frame type Full duplex cradle

The Honda Motosport 90 or Honda SL90 was a street/trail Honda motorcycle with a high fender. Its engine was a single cylinder 89cc, single overhead cam configuration. It had a 4-speed transmission and a manual clutch. It was produced only during the 1969 model year and was available in two colors: Candy Ruby Red and Candy Blue. It came with a silver fuel tank stripe and a chrome exhaust system. Its frame was silver with the front wheel measuring 19" and 17" for the rear wheel. The steel fenders matched the basic colors (red or blue).
